Ex-Paralympian uses prosthetic arm to play violin – and performs at the opening ceremony

‘They are saying that because no one has done it before. So I will do it.’ (Picture: AFP|Getty Images)
A Japanese former elite athlete enthralled thousands with a brief but breathtaking performance at the opening ceremony of the Tokyo Paralympics – and playing violin isn’t even her day job.
